Six computer subassemblies (NSN 7050-01-609-7571) from Technical Marine Services Inc., P/N 006750, are required. Each subassembly must be individually packaged and clearly marked with NSN 7050-01-609-7571, and packaged IAW ASTM-D-3951 and SP-PP&M-001 to protect sensitive electronics. Deliveries are FOB destination to a Coast Guard logistics facility in Baltimore, with the items marked for Receiving Room Building 88 and delivered by the required date.

This is a firm-fixed-price, all-or-none solicitation for a commercial item under simplified acquisition procedures. Quoted offers from responsible sources that conform to the requirements will be considered; the award will be the lowest price technically acceptable. Vendors must be SAM-registered, provide a valid DUNS number and Tax Identification Number, and submit the required representations and certifications (as specified in the solicitation). Inverted domestic corporation disclosures may apply. Quotes must be received by the stated closing time.
